West Covina, CA (January 24, 2026) – A crash resulting in injuries was reported Friday evening in West Covina, prompting a swift response from local first responders. The incident occurred around 6:30 p.m. on January 23 in the 14000 block of Francisquito Ave, just west of Sunset Ave.
Paramedics and fire crews responded promptly and worked to assist multiple individuals suffering from a variety of injuries at the scene. At least one vehicle was involved in the crash, though authorities have not yet disclosed the total number of parties affected or the extent of the damage.
The collision led to temporary traffic disruptions as emergency personnel treated the injured and secured the area. Details surrounding the cause of the crash remain under investigation by law enforcement officials, who are working to determine the series of events that led to the incident.
